Boat and beach report for Tuesday, July 14 2009
6:50 AM
Clear skies and comfortable conditions can be expected today through tomorrow evening as high pressure remains in control of the region. A weak cold front will approach on Tuesday night with increasing clouds. On Wednesday, the cold front will move through the region with widely scattered showers and thunderstorms, otherwise partly cloudy skies are expected.
Winds will be from the west around 5 to 10 mph through this afternoon. Tonight, winds will veer from the west to northwest around 5 to 10 mph. On Wednesday, winds will back to the southwest around 5 to 10 mph. Winds will remain from the southwest through Wednesday, but increase to 5 to 15 mph.
Temperatures will rise into the upper 70’s to lower 80’s for afternoon highs today. On Wednesday, temperatures will fall into the lower 60’s for morning lows and rebound into the upper 70’s to lower 80’s for afternoon highs. On Thursday, temperatures will fall into the mid to upper 60’s for morning lows and rebound into the lower to mid 80’s for afternoon highs.
Water temperatures will range from the upper 60’s to lower 70’s over the Long Island Sound, northern New Jersey coastal waters, and east of Long Island; lower to mid 70’s over the central and southern New Jersey coastal waters; and upper 70’s to lower 80’s in the Delaware Bay and Delaware River.
Wave heights will range from 2 to 4 feet through the period.
